Factory explosion



By Our Staff Correspondent


QUETTA, March 11: A powerful explosion on Friday afternoon left five workers injured in a steel factory in Killi Karani, on the outskirts of Quetta.

Labourers were busy in Bolan Steel Factory when a pipe exploded in the foundry and injured the workers. They were admitted to the civil hospital sources said.

“The pipe was thrown in the foundry with scrap,” an injured labour told reporters. However, he ruled out any subversion behind the accident.

Police also said it was not a bomb blast. The injured include Abdul Sattar, Mohammad Arshad, Abdul Hameed, Tahir Mohammad and Abdul Sattar Shah.
